Amazon Redshift
- Amazon Redshift: คลังข้อมูลบนคลาวด์สำหรับนักวิเคราะห์ข้อมูลและการเทรดไบนารี่ออปชั่น
Amazon Redshift คืออะไร? ทำไมถึงสำคัญสำหรับนักเทรดไบนารี่ออปชั่น และเราจะนำข้อมูลจาก Redshift มาใช้ในการวิเคราะห์ตลาดได้อย่างไร? บทความนี้จะพาคุณไปทำความรู้จักกับ Amazon Redshift ตั้งแต่พื้นฐานไปจนถึงการประยุกต์ใช้งานจริง โดยเน้นมุมมองที่เกี่ยวข้องกับการเทรดไบนารี่ออปชั่นและการวิเคราะห์ข้อมูลทางการเงิน
- 1. บทนำสู่ Amazon Redshift
Amazon Redshift คือบริการคลังข้อมูล (Data Warehouse) แบบจัดการเต็มรูปแบบ (Fully Managed) ที่ให้บริการโดย Amazon Web Services (AWS) ซึ่งออกแบบมาเพื่อการวิเคราะห์ข้อมูลขนาดใหญ่ (Big Data) อย่างรวดเร็วและมีประสิทธิภาพ Redshift ช่วยให้องค์กรสามารถจัดเก็บ ประมวลผล และวิเคราะห์ข้อมูลจำนวนมหาศาลได้อย่างง่ายดาย โดยไม่ต้องกังวลเรื่องการจัดการโครงสร้างพื้นฐาน (Infrastructure) เอง
- ความแตกต่างระหว่าง Data Warehouse และ Database ทั่วไป:**
- **Database (ฐานข้อมูล):** เน้นการทำธุรกรรมแบบเรียลไทม์ (Real-time transactions) เช่น การบันทึกการซื้อขายหุ้น การจัดการข้อมูลลูกค้า ฐานข้อมูลแบบดั้งเดิม เช่น MySQL, PostgreSQL เหมาะสำหรับการใช้งานที่ต้องการความรวดเร็วในการอ่านและเขียนข้อมูลทีละรายการ
- **Data Warehouse (คลังข้อมูล):** เน้นการวิเคราะห์ข้อมูลในอดีตเพื่อหาแนวโน้มและรูปแบบ (Patterns) ที่ซ่อนอยู่ คลังข้อมูลจะรวบรวมข้อมูลจากแหล่งต่างๆ มาจัดเก็บในรูปแบบที่เหมาะสมกับการวิเคราะห์ เช่น ข้อมูลการซื้อขายในอดีต ข้อมูลเศรษฐกิจ ข้อมูลทางสังคม Redshift เหมาะสำหรับการใช้งานที่ต้องการประสิทธิภาพในการอ่านข้อมูลจำนวนมากเพื่อทำการวิเคราะห์
- 2. สถาปัตยกรรมของ Amazon Redshift
Redshift มีสถาปัตยกรรมแบบ Massively Parallel Processing (MPP) ซึ่งหมายความว่าข้อมูลจะถูกแบ่งออกเป็นส่วนๆ (Data partitions) และกระจายไปเก็บไว้ในหลายๆ โหนด (Nodes) ทำให้การประมวลผลสามารถทำได้แบบขนาน (Parallel) ส่งผลให้การวิเคราะห์ข้อมูลขนาดใหญ่เป็นไปได้อย่างรวดเร็ว
- องค์ประกอบหลักของ Redshift:**
- **Cluster:** กลุ่มของโหนดที่ทำงานร่วมกันเพื่อจัดเก็บและประมวลผลข้อมูล
- **Node:** หน่วยประมวลผลและจัดเก็บข้อมูลแต่ละตัวใน Cluster
- **Leader Node:** ทำหน้าที่รับคำสั่งจากผู้ใช้ และกระจายคำสั่งไปยัง Compute Nodes
- **Compute Node:** ทำหน้าที่ประมวลผลข้อมูลตามคำสั่งที่ได้รับจาก Leader Node
- **Data Partition:** ส่วนแบ่งของข้อมูลที่ถูกกระจายไปเก็บไว้ใน Compute Nodes
- 3. คุณสมบัติเด่นของ Amazon Redshift
- **Scalability:** สามารถปรับขนาด Cluster ได้ตามต้องการ โดยเพิ่มหรือลดจำนวน Nodes ได้อย่างง่ายดาย
- **Performance:** สถาปัตยกรรม MPP ทำให้การวิเคราะห์ข้อมูลขนาดใหญ่เป็นไปได้อย่างรวดเร็ว
- **Cost-effectiveness:** จ่ายเฉพาะทรัพยากรที่ใช้งานจริง (Pay-as-you-go)
- **Security:** มีระบบรักษาความปลอดภัยที่เข้มงวด เช่น การเข้ารหัสข้อมูล การควบคุมการเข้าถึง
- **Integration:** สามารถทำงานร่วมกับบริการอื่นๆ ของ AWS ได้อย่างราบรื่น เช่น S3, EMR, Glue
- **SQL Compatibility:** รองรับ SQL มาตรฐาน ทำให้ง่ายต่อการใช้งานสำหรับผู้ที่มีความคุ้นเคยกับ SQL
- 4. การนำข้อมูลมาใส่ใน Amazon Redshift
ข้อมูลสามารถนำเข้าสู่ Redshift ได้จากหลายแหล่ง เช่น:
- **Amazon S3:** บริการจัดเก็บข้อมูลบนคลาวด์ของ AWS เป็นแหล่งข้อมูลที่นิยมใช้ในการนำเข้าข้อมูลเข้าสู่ Redshift
- **Database:** สามารถนำเข้าข้อมูลจากฐานข้อมูลอื่นๆ เช่น MySQL, PostgreSQL โดยใช้เครื่องมือต่างๆ เช่น AWS Database Migration Service (DMS)
- **Streaming Data:** สามารถนำเข้าข้อมูลแบบ Streaming จากแหล่งต่างๆ เช่น Apache Kafka, Kinesis
- **ETL Tools:** ใช้เครื่องมือ ETL (Extract, Transform, Load) เช่น AWS Glue เพื่อดึงข้อมูลจากแหล่งต่างๆ มาแปลงรูปแบบ และนำเข้าสู่ Redshift
- 5. Amazon Redshift กับการเทรดไบนารี่ออปชั่น: การวิเคราะห์ข้อมูลเพื่อเพิ่มโอกาสในการทำกำไร
นี่คือจุดที่น่าสนใจที่สุดสำหรับนักเทรดไบนารี่ออปชั่น Redshift สามารถนำมาใช้ในการวิเคราะห์ข้อมูลตลาดเพื่อหาโอกาสในการเทรดที่มีความน่าจะเป็นสูงขึ้นได้อย่างไร?
- **Historical Data Analysis (การวิเคราะห์ข้อมูลย้อนหลัง):** จัดเก็บข้อมูลราคาในอดีตของสินทรัพย์ต่างๆ (เช่น หุ้น, Forex, สินค้าโภคภัณฑ์) ใน Redshift และใช้ SQL ในการวิเคราะห์เพื่อหาแนวโน้ม (Trends) และรูปแบบ (Patterns) ต่างๆ เช่น การเกิด Head and Shoulders, Double Top/Bottom, Triangles ซึ่งเป็นพื้นฐานของการเทรดด้วย รูปแบบกราฟ
- **Technical Indicator Calculation (การคำนวณตัวชี้วัดทางเทคนิค):** คำนวณตัวชี้วัดทางเทคนิคต่างๆ เช่น Moving Averages, Relative Strength Index (RSI), MACD บนข้อมูลราคาในอดีต เพื่อหาสัญญาณซื้อขาย
- **Backtesting (การทดสอบย้อนหลัง):** ทดสอบกลยุทธ์การเทรดต่างๆ บนข้อมูลในอดีตเพื่อประเมินประสิทธิภาพก่อนนำไปใช้จริง Backtesting กลยุทธ์
- **Sentiment Analysis (การวิเคราะห์ความรู้สึก):** นำข้อมูลข่าวสารและโซเชียลมีเดียมาวิเคราะห์เพื่อวัดความรู้สึกของนักลงทุนที่มีต่อสินทรัพย์ต่างๆ ซึ่งอาจมีผลต่อราคา การวิเคราะห์ความรู้สึก
- **Volume Analysis (การวิเคราะห์ปริมาณการซื้อขาย):** วิเคราะห์ปริมาณการซื้อขายเพื่อหาความแข็งแกร่งของแนวโน้มและยืนยันสัญญาณซื้อขาย การวิเคราะห์ปริมาณการซื้อขาย
- **Correlation Analysis (การวิเคราะห์ความสัมพันธ์):** วิเคราะห์ความสัมพันธ์ระหว่างสินทรัพย์ต่างๆ เพื่อหาโอกาสในการเทรดแบบ Pair Trading การเทรดแบบ Pair Trading
- ตัวอย่างการใช้งาน SQL ใน Redshift เพื่อคำนวณ Moving Average:**
```sql SELECT
date, close_price, AVG(close_price) OVER (ORDER BY date ASC ROWS BETWEEN 6 PRECEDING AND CURRENT ROW) AS moving_average_7_days
FROM
stock_prices
WHERE
symbol = 'AAPL';
```
โค้ดนี้จะคำนวณ Moving Average 7 วันสำหรับหุ้น Apple (AAPL) โดยใช้ข้อมูลราคาปิด (close\_price) จากตาราง stock\_prices
- 6. การเชื่อมต่อ Amazon Redshift กับเครื่องมือวิเคราะห์ข้อมูล
Redshift สามารถเชื่อมต่อกับเครื่องมือวิเคราะห์ข้อมูลต่างๆ ได้อย่างง่ายดาย เช่น:
- **Tableau:** เครื่องมือสร้าง Visualization ที่ได้รับความนิยม
- **Power BI:** เครื่องมือสร้าง Visualization จาก Microsoft
- **Python:** สามารถใช้ Python libraries เช่น psycopg2 เพื่อเชื่อมต่อกับ Redshift และทำการวิเคราะห์ข้อมูล
- **R:** สามารถใช้ R packages เช่น RedshiftUtils เพื่อเชื่อมต่อกับ Redshift และทำการวิเคราะห์ข้อมูล
- 7. ข้อควรพิจารณาในการใช้งาน Amazon Redshift
- **Data Modeling:** การออกแบบ Schema ของข้อมูลให้เหมาะสมมีความสำคัญอย่างยิ่งต่อประสิทธิภาพในการวิเคราะห์
- **Distribution Style:** เลือก Distribution Style ที่เหมาะสมกับข้อมูลและรูปแบบการ Query
- **Compression:** ใช้ Compression เพื่อลดขนาดของข้อมูลและเพิ่มประสิทธิภาพในการ Query
- **Vacuuming and Analyzing:** ทำ Vacuuming และ Analyzing เป็นประจำเพื่อปรับปรุงประสิทธิภาพในการ Query
- **Cost Management:** ตรวจสอบและบริหารจัดการค่าใช้จ่ายอย่างสม่ำเสมอ
- 8. กลยุทธ์การเทรดไบนารี่ออปชั่นที่ใช้ข้อมูลจาก Redshift
- **Trend Following with Moving Averages:** ใช้ Moving Averages ที่คำนวณจาก Redshift เพื่อระบุแนวโน้มของราคาและเทรดตามแนวโน้มนั้น กลยุทธ์ Trend Following
- **Overbought/Oversold with RSI:** ใช้ RSI ที่คำนวณจาก Redshift เพื่อระบุสภาวะ Overbought/Oversold และเทรดในทิศทางตรงกันข้าม กลยุทธ์ RSI
- **Breakout Trading:** ใช้ข้อมูลราคาในอดีตจาก Redshift เพื่อระบุระดับแนวรับและแนวต้าน และเทรดเมื่อราคา Breakout ผ่านระดับเหล่านั้น กลยุทธ์ Breakout
- **News-Based Trading:** ใช้ข้อมูลข่าวสารและ Sentiment Analysis จาก Redshift เพื่อเทรดตามข่าวสารและเหตุการณ์สำคัญ กลยุทธ์ News Trading
- **Volatility Trading:** ใช้ข้อมูลความผันผวนที่คำนวณจาก Redshift เพื่อเทรดในทิศทางที่คาดว่าจะมีความผันผวนสูงขึ้น กลยุทธ์ Volatility Trading
- **Pin Bar Strategy:** ค้นหารูปแบบ Pin Bar ในข้อมูลย้อนหลังที่จัดเก็บใน Redshift เพื่อหาจุดกลับตัวของราคา กลยุทธ์ Pin Bar
- **Engulfing Pattern Strategy:** วิเคราะห์ข้อมูลเพื่อหากลุ่ม Engulfing Patterns ซึ่งเป็นสัญญาณของการเปลี่ยนแนวโน้ม กลยุทธ์ Engulfing
- **Three White Soldiers Strategy:** ระบุรูปแบบ Three White Soldiers ในข้อมูลเพื่อยืนยันแนวโน้มขาขึ้น กลยุทธ์ Three White Soldiers
- **Dark Cloud Cover Strategy:** ค้นหารูปแบบ Dark Cloud Cover เพื่อหาระบุสัญญาณของการกลับตัวเป็นขาลง กลยุทธ์ Dark Cloud Cover
- **Morning Star Strategy:** วิเคราะห์ข้อมูลเพื่อหารูปแบบ Morning Star ซึ่งเป็นสัญญาณของการกลับตัวเป็นขาขึ้น กลยุทธ์ Morning Star
- **Hammer and Hanging Man Strategy:** ใช้ข้อมูลเพื่อระบุรูปแบบ Hammer และ Hanging Man เพื่อหาจุดกลับตัวของราคา กลยุทธ์ Hammer/Hanging Man
- **Doji Strategy:** วิเคราะห์ข้อมูลเพื่อหา Doji Patterns ซึ่งเป็นสัญญาณของความไม่แน่นอนในตลาด กลยุทธ์ Doji
- **Harami Pattern Strategy:** ค้นหารูปแบบ Harami เพื่อหาระบุสัญญาณของการกลับตัวของราคา กลยุทธ์ Harami
- **Three Black Crows Strategy:** ระบุรูปแบบ Three Black Crows เพื่อยืนยันแนวโน้มขาลง กลยุทธ์ Three Black Crows
- **Inside Bar Strategy:** วิเคราะห์ข้อมูลเพื่อหา Inside Bar Patterns ซึ่งเป็นสัญญาณของการพักตัวของแนวโน้ม กลยุทธ์ Inside Bar
- 9. สรุป
Amazon Redshift เป็นเครื่องมือที่มีประสิทธิภาพสำหรับนักวิเคราะห์ข้อมูลและนักเทรดไบนารี่ออปชั่น ด้วยความสามารถในการจัดเก็บ ประมวลผล และวิเคราะห์ข้อมูลขนาดใหญ่ได้อย่างรวดเร็ว Redshift สามารถช่วยให้คุณค้นพบแนวโน้มและรูปแบบที่ซ่อนอยู่ ซึ่งจะช่วยเพิ่มโอกาสในการทำกำไรในการเทรดไบนารี่ออปชั่นได้
การจัดการความเสี่ยงในการเทรดไบนารี่ออปชั่น เป็นสิ่งสำคัญควบคู่ไปกับการวิเคราะห์ข้อมูล อย่าลืมกำหนดขนาด Position ที่เหมาะสม และใช้ Stop-Loss เพื่อจำกัดความเสี่ยงของคุณ
แหล่งข้อมูลเพิ่มเติมเกี่ยวกับ Amazon Redshift
การเลือกโบรกเกอร์ไบนารี่ออปชั่นที่เหมาะสม
การทำความเข้าใจความเสี่ยงในการเทรดไบนารี่ออปชั่น
เริ่มต้นการซื้อขายตอนนี้
ลงทะเบียนกับ IQ Option (เงินฝากขั้นต่ำ $10) เปิดบัญชีกับ Pocket Option (เงินฝากขั้นต่ำ $5)
เข้าร่วมชุมชนของเรา
สมัครสมาชิกช่อง Telegram ของเรา @strategybin เพื่อรับ: ✓ สัญญาณการซื้อขายรายวัน ✓ การวิเคราะห์เชิงกลยุทธ์แบบพิเศษ ✓ การแจ้งเตือนแนวโน้มตลาด ✓ วัสดุการศึกษาสำหรับผู้เริ่มต้น

